Efficient and self-improving
The router sends every request down the cheapest capable path, and every human decision makes the system smarter.
Model routing as policy
Deterministic rules run first, ML models second, language models last, and model choice is configuration, never code.
Cost governance built in
Token usage is recorded per call, departments get monthly AI budgets and per-action caps, and expensive jobs batch off peak.
Decisions become training data
Every accept, edit, and reject is captured as label data that retrains models and improves skills over time.
Knowledge that travels
Curated knowledge bundles seed a new deployment on day one, carrying permissions, provenance, and classification with the data.

Common questions about Custom Software.
Are we starting from zero on a custom build?
No. A new system composes the proven control plane with your domain object model, your skill packs, and seeded knowledge bundles, built to your needs, so governance, audit, ML, and routing arrive already built.
Are we locked into one AI provider?
No. Mission logic stays separate from model choice. The router runs across approved hosted models and local runtimes, and nothing outside the router references a provider by name.
Can the AI act without a human?
Consequential actions hold at human gates, and hard guardrails are enforced in code. Autonomy is progressive, moving from supervised pilot to gated independence as evidence accumulates.
